I had the 3M clear bra put on my 2006 DTS the early part of last summer. I love it.

In addition to the entire front fascia, first 18 inches of the hood, mirrors and extra thick film on the headlights, I had my installer custom make a piece for the TOP of the rear bumper. That way you don't scratch the bumper taking stuff in and out of the trunk. I have the White Lightning Tri Coat. You could never match the paint color if you scratched it.

Alco had the windows tinted and a real pale gold pinstripe applied.

I've looked at clear bra's before but they raise two questions that I have yet to see an answer for:

1. What happens if you want to take it OFF? Suppose, for example, it starts to look ratty after a few years and you want to redo it? Can it be removed without damaging the paint?

2. Does it cause the paint to fade/wear unevenly so that after several years there is an obvious line between where the bra is or has been, and the area not covered?

It's visible if you are standing right on top of the car, but if you are 3 feet back it can't be seen. I've had several walk right up to the car and not be able to see it until they are litterly next to it.
